Output 43beb0b160a790ce47ec721b986b20a8af5c34a56bc131e0b3ad80dd7b0b8f5d: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89860ed469d2643eb1e537dc59e7e51456346638 OP_EQUAL
address
2N5nPA5BUxhyW4c7FWba6Tjf112P6p8Y1Uj
transaction
43beb0b160a790ce47ec721b986b20a8af5c34a56bc131e0b3ad80dd7b0b8f5d